Legal Pathways to Getting a Polish Driver's License
Depending on where you presently hold a license and your residency status, the process falls into 3 main classifications:
CategoryDescriptionRequirementsEU/EEA License HoldersLicenses released by any EU or EFTA member state are fully acknowledged in Poland.Valid license, evidence of residency (if staying long-lasting, optional exchange).Non-EU License ExchangeFor nations that signed the 1968 Vienna Convention on Road Traffic.Exchange possible after 185 days of residency; generally needs passing a theoretical test.New Drivers (From Scratch)For people without any prior license or from non-reciprocal countries.Full training: medical examination, theoretical course, practical lessons, and state tests.Step-by-Step Guide: Earning a License from Scratch

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I drive in Poland with my foreign driver's license?
Yes, if you are checking out as a traveler, your home country's license-- together with an International Driving Permit (IDP) if your license is not in English or Polish-- is generally valid for as much as 6 months. If you develop residency, stricter timelines use.
2. Can I take the driving exams in English?
Yes. Significant WORD centers in cities like Warsaw, Kraków, Wrocław, and Poznań provide theoretical exams in English. For the useful exam, you may bring a sworn translator at your own expense, though some examiners speak conversational English.
3. What takes place if I get captured using a fake "purchased" motorist's license?
Using a created document is a criminal offense under Article 270 of the Polish Penal Code. It can result in heavy fines, constraint of liberty, or jail time for up to 5 years, together with a permanent restriction from acquiring a legal license.
